About Jagoda

Jagoda is an AI-powered tutoring platform designed to assist students with homework across a range of subjects including mathematics, science, languages, and additional academic disciplines. The tool appears to offer step-by-step guidance, breaking down problems into manageable parts to facilitate understanding and learning. It is marketed as a free resource, though users should verify current pricing and any potential limitations on the official website or platform.

The service is accessible via web, likely requiring an internet connection. While the exact feature set is not detailed in the available information, the core functionality revolves around providing explanatory assistance tailored to student queries. It may incorporate natural language processing to interpret and respond to user inputs, delivering clear, structured solutions.

As part of the broader category of AI education tools, Jagoda aims to support learners outside of traditional classroom settings, offering on-demand help. The tool's scope spans multiple subjects, making it a versatile option for students seeking clarification or step-by-step problem-solving methods. Users should be aware that output quality and coverage may vary depending on the complexity of the question and the specific subject matter.
